    Abstract: The present invention relates to a method, a system and a computer program product for determining a position relative to a confined space. For this purpose, one or more UWB anchors are provided on the confined space, a distance of the UWB item relative to the one or more UWB anchors is repeatedly determined, a variability is determined based on the repeatedly determined distances and it is determined whether the UWB item is in the confined space, by comparing said variability with a predetermined variability limit value.

    Abstract: The invention relates to a computer system and method for high availability processing through a session on a transport connection, for use in a cluster with at least two nodes. The system comprises a protocol component; a cluster with at least two nodes, said cluster being arranged for running the protocol component; and a server arranged for maintaining a protocol session on a transport connection with a node of the cluster. The cluster is arranged for maintaining on each of said at least two nodes one instance of the protocol component, so that at least two instances are active; the server is arranged for simultaneously maintaining a protocol session with each instance.

    Abstract: A method for dynamically assigning resources of a distributed server infrastructure, the method comprising the steps of comparing an observed relative load of an assigned portion of said distributed server infrastructure with a desired relative load; if said observed relative load exceeds said desired relative load assigning additional resources, and redistributing tasks from said assigned portion to said additional resources; and if said desired relative load exceeds said desired relative load: selecting removable resources, redistributing tasks from said removable resources to other resources in said assigned portion, and removing said removable resources from said assigned portion; wherein said redistributing of tasks is performed in such a way that state information related to said tasks is preserved.

    Abstract: A method for transferring state information pertaining to a plurality of SIP conversations from a first SIP server to a second SIP server, said first SIP server and said second SIP server being operatively connected to one or more SIP gateways, the method comprising at a controlling node: monitoring said first SIP server until ongoing transactions are terminated; after termination of said ongoing transactions, obtaining dialog state information pertaining to conversations managed by said first SIP server from said first SIP server; and storing said obtained dialog state information at said second SIP server.

    Abstract: A method of removing an instance of a stateful session bean from a passive state, and a computer program product to execute this method. An event initiates the removal of said instance of the SFSB from the passive state to a does-not-exist state. Upon that event, a function of a container managing the SFSB is triggered. Said function handles the release of external state objects associated with the instance of the SFSB upon removing the instance of the SFSB. In one preferred embodiment of the method introducing a new type of callback method, said instance of the SFSB is partially reactivated, after calling said new type of callback method on said instance of the SFSB, by setting said instance of the SFSB in a near remove state between the passive state and the does-not-exist state.

    Abstract: Methods for providing internet-layer addresses from serving devices (1) via relaying devices (4) to client devices (3) comprise the steps of, at the relaying devices (4), receiving first messages (101a) from the client devices (3) and second messages (102a) from the serving devices and transmitting further first messages (101b) to the serving devices (1) and further second messages (102b) to the client devices (3). To allow the relaying devices (4) to monitor certain traffic relatively sufficiently, the method is provided with the step of, at the relaying devices (4), inserting internet-layer (internet protocol=layer-3) addresses defining the relaying devices (4) into higher-layer (user datagram protocol=layer-4) fields of the further second messages (102b), which higher-layer fields were originally designed for identifying the serving devices (1). As a result, future messages to be sent from the client devices (3) to the serving devices (1) must pass the relaying devices (4).

    Abstract: The present invention relates to a network unit in a telecommunication network for forwarding a Layer 2 packet such as an Ethernet packet encapsulating a Layer 3 packet such as an Internet protocol packet in its payload. The Layer 2 packet being received at one of the interfaces of the network unit. The network unit therefore comprises: a forwarding database that comprises associations between an interface of the plurality of interfaces and at least one Layer 3 address. The forwarding database returns upon reception of a Layer 3 address which has a full match with one of said Layer 3 addresses in the forwarding database, the associated interface of the plurality of interfaces; and an extractor for extracting from a payload of the Layer 2 packet a destination Layer 3 address; and a forwarding engine for in response to this extraction, retrieving from the forwarding database and based upon this extracted destination Layer 3 address, the associated interface.
